Job Description:

As a PKI Architect ECU Cybersecurity, you will be responsible for developing secure PKI-based authentication and encryption mechanisms, supporting cybersecurity risk assessments, and guiding the organization toward compliance with industry standards and best practices.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design and implement PKI architectures for ECU subscribers (onboard and offboard).
  • Support and contribute to Threat Analysis and Risk Assessment (TARA) reviews.
  • Develop and implement cybersecurity controls and countermeasures for vehicle ECUs.
  • Lead and coordinate cross-functional teams in global cybersecurity initiatives.
  • Educate, mentor, and guide colleagues in cybersecurity and PKI solution development.
  • Ensure compliance with international security frameworks and regulatory standards.

Mandatory / Primary Skills

  • Expertise in PKI (Public Key Infrastructure) Architecture: Extensive experience as a PKI Architect, focusing on ECU subscriber systems with strong knowledge of both onboard and offboard PKI components.
  • Cybersecurity Concepts & Controls: Proven experience implementing cybersecurity solutions and controls for vehicle ECUs across onboard and offboard environments.
  • Network Protocols: Strong understanding of TLS, IPSec, Ethernet, and wireless communication protocols.
  • Leadership: Demonstrated ability to lead cross-functional working groups composed of people with diverse technical and cultural backgrounds.
  • C-ITS Knowledge: Familiarity with Cooperative Intelligent Transport Systems and Services (C-ITS).
  • ISO 15118 Expertise: Working knowledge of ISO 15118-2 and ISO 15118-20 vehicle-to-grid communication standards.
  • Security Frameworks: Deep understanding of key cybersecurity and functional safety standards, including
    • ISO/SAE 21434 (Road Vehicle Cybersecurity)
    • ISO/IEC 27000 (Information Security Management Systems)
    • ISO 26262 (Functional Safety)
    • UNECE R155 (Cybersecurity Management System)
    • Other relevant industry standards and regulations
